Antonio Rudiger has admitted his surprise at how well Chelsea FC have started the new season under Maurizio Sarri.
The Blues boss was brought in as the club’s new manager back in July after Chelsea FC opted to sack Antonio Conte.
The Italian manager has been getting to grips with life at Stamford Bridge and has been earning lots of praise for the immediate impact he has had at the west London club.
Sarri’s side have managed to notch up a 100 per cent record in the Premier League so far this season by winning all four of their opening games in the top flight.
And Chelsea FC defender Rudiger has admitted that the Blues’ form has come as something of a surprise to him, because so many of the club’s players were involved in the World Cup.
Speaking to the Daily Mail, Rudiger said: “To be honest, I’m surprised how well we’ve done because players like Eden Hazard and N’Golo Kante had big World Cups and came back late for training.
“They are in good shape and that’s impressive.”
Chelsea FC will return to Premier League action after the international break when they take on Cardiff City at Stamford Bridge.
The west London side finished in fifth place in the Premier League table last season under Conte.
